Wharton at the Centre of a Three-Way Tug of War

Crystal Palace's midfield general Adam Wharton has been priced up on the next club specials market with bet365, and it's one of the more finely balanced transfer stories on any of the best football betting sites this summer. 

Palace themselves head the market at 6/4 to keep him at Selhurst Park beyond this window, an implied 40% probability, with Chelsea (2/1) and Liverpool (5/2) locked into the two closest chasing positions.

That's a genuinely competitive three-way top of the market, a shape you don't often see in transfer specials, where one destination club usually pulls clear as reporting cycles tighten. 

The pricing here reflects the fact that both Chelsea and Liverpool have been linked with concrete interest, and neither has been dismissed by the bookies as the summer approaches its business end.

Adam Wharton Next Club Full Odds

Adam Wharton Next Club
OddsImplied Probability
Crystal Palace (Stay)6/440.00%
Chelsea2/133.33%
Liverpool5/228.57%
Tottenham7/112.50%
Manchester United10/19.09%
Nottingham Forest10/19.09%

Palace at 6/4 as the shortest price on the board reflects a fairly clear market reading of the club's negotiating position. Wharton is under contract, Palace have no financial pressure forcing a sale, and the club's recent transfer track record has been one of selling on their terms. 

All of that feeds into a favourite price on the "stay" option in a summer where multiple clubs are pushing.

A summer of retaining key players would give Palace the kind of continuity that has been central to their more recent Premier League seasons, and the club's decision-making cycle has, in recent windows, favoured selling only when the offer is one the market cannot reasonably match.

The Chelsea and Liverpool Push at the Top

Chelsea at 2/1 (33.33% implied) and Liverpool at 5/2 (28.57% implied) are the only clubs on the board priced inside a genuine window of realistic contention, and both quotes reflect reporting that has attached each side to concrete interest rather than casual speculation.

Wharton's profile, press-resistant, ball-progressive, comfortable dictating tempo from deep, is precisely the type of English midfielder Chelsea's recruitment cycle has consistently gravitated toward.

The Anfield connection is a live one, and bookmakers pricing him at 28.57% suggests the trading desk views Liverpool's interest as concrete rather than speculative.
